Property owner displaced after fire in Randleman

More than a dozen cars, three outbuildings, and a mobile home caught fire.

RANDLEMAN, N.C. — Randleman Fire officials said a large junkyard fire is out on a property owner's land. The owner had to leave because of the damage. 

The fire started Monday evening. It took crews two to three hours to put the fire on Idlewild Drive Extension out. 

Viewer photos shared with WFMY News 2 showing large dark clouds of smoke just behind an automotive shop on North Fayetteville Street. 

Fire Marshal Michael Smith said around 15 vehicles were involved in the fire, as well as two small outbuildings, one larger outbuilding, and a mobile home. No one was hurt. 

The cause of the fire remains undetermined, and no estimated damages were provided. WFMY News 2 made it to the scene Tuesday morning as Randleman Fire Department arrived to put out hot spots.

The owner of the property was displaced because of the fire and is receiving help from the Red Cross.
